Output 6e8e6d351f6fa054da4c47e43356336d4bb039a579cbe9dc39ef4091d12ffec4:0

value
329322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c382268a04ba296392a30a7ada1c4d3862ea5340 OP_EQUAL
address
3KWmby9ukdJnPDa6ujMa3nNuQuFPJ4RcMk
transaction
6e8e6d351f6fa054da4c47e43356336d4bb039a579cbe9dc39ef4091d12ffec4
confirmations
323097
spent
true